BUZZ POPPY VIDEO CO

A movie titled 'BUZZ POPPY', available in both English and Chinese languages. The exact details of the film are a bit garbled, but it seems to be produced by VIDEO CO.

£3

inc processing £3.34

from NR2
Local pickup only